GnuDB is a service that was set up prior to the closure of freedb used for hosting CDDB data that uses the CDDB1 format.

With the formal closure of freedb in 2019, a number of applications now use GnuDB as their freedb replacement.

Configuration

In general, applications only need to have freedb.freedb.org changed to gnudb.gnudb.org.

Should an application not support HTTP 1.1, the following proxy settings can be used:

  • Proxy server: proxy.gnudb.org
  • Port: 3128

An alternate solution for some Windows users may be to update their "hosts" file with the following:

92.246.24.225 freedb.freedb.org
